Portrait of Two Women (possibly Adela Geddes (1791-1881), the Artist's Wife, and a Friend), Andrew Geddes

Object Type: painting. Genre: portrait. Date: between circa 1820 and circa 1830. Dimensions: height: 20 cm (7.8 in) ; width: 17 cm (6.6 in). Collection: National Galleries Scotland.
